Résumé
Four months after her mother is murdered, Johanna must choose between vengeance and protecting the Kingdom she was born to serve. Princess Johanna must ascend the Throne of Solaria when her mother sacrifices herself trying to protect an ancient artifact within the Ivory Halls of the Obsidian Tower. Sitting on the Throne of Solaria is the last thing she anticipated when only months before she had been planning on marrying her long time friend and crush.
Worse still, the nightmares of a ruined world won't let her sleep. The only thing she needs is to finally ascend the Throne so she can finally start her hunt for vengeance. When Setsuna, a leader of another country, turns up during Johanna's coronation to ask for Johanna's help in finding her kidnapped mate who had been taken by the same people who killed her mother, Johanna knows she has to leave everything and everyone she has known to travel across the world with her best friend Dedria Heart and the summoned familiar of Solaria, Pendra. What she doesn't expect is being chosen by Arcanis, the Goddess of the Suns, and suddenly having the souls of four long-dead warriors occupying her mind called the Archons.
They claim she's the Ash Queen and will bring forth a peace the realm has never known before. The Archons make it clear though; the cost of peace will be high, and there might only be ashes left. While balancing her quest for revenge against her mother's killer and the duty to protect her country and people, the new Queen comes to realize the relic stolen is far more dangerous and world-changing than she had been led to believe and the prophecy she's been warned about is lingering on the horizon if she doesn't stop it in time.
